Quote:
Originally Posted by AxxSxxB View Post
Of course. Just saying what it costs. Anyways, how much do you guys think all of the parts needed for the LSX swap would cost? Also, what all needs to be replaced?
I would assume at a minimum $15k, but probably closer to the $25k range (or higher depending on how much power you want to make).

To buy and build a motor will run you about $5k for a mild build. You build it to hold performance tack on another $3k-$8k. You'll need a matching trans, custom drive shaft, rear end, etc.

Are you going carb'd or EFI? Sensors galore, and lots of custom fabrication to make it fix.

I'd say budget $20k at least, and plan for at least 6 months to a year down time.
